Proceeding contribution from Lord Beith (Liberal Democrat) in the House of Commons on Tuesday, 29 November 2011. It occurred during Debate on bill on Public Bodies Bill [Lords].


Public Bodies Bill [Lords]

It is an unusual experience for a Committee to publish just after midnight a report containing recommendations that are accepted by midday the following day. As my hon. Friend has mentioned youth offending teams, I wanted to remind him that the Justice Committee, as well as pointing to the dangers of abolishing the Youth Justice Board, stated that if it survived it would have to take a lighter touch and a less centralised approach to the management of youth offending teams than it had taken in the otherwise good work it had done.
